Job Summary

As the Retail Manager, you will be responsible for overseeing the day-to-day operations of our retail outlets, including bar and food services. You will lead a team, manage stock and resources, ensure adherence to legal and health standards, and develop strategies to maximise sales and profitability. Your role is crucial in delivering high-quality service and a great experience for our guests.

Job Duties

  • Develop and implement an effective business plan to maximise bar and food sales opportunities, driving revenue through strategic marketing and product displays.
  • Recruit, train, and manage the performance of the retail team, ensuring high standards of customer service, cleanliness, and professionalism.
  • Oversee the control and rotation of stock from approved suppliers, ensuring optimal stock levels, quality, and minimising wastage.
  • Prepare, plan, and manage the retail budget, monitoring financial performance and achieving KPIs related to sales, profitability, and cost control.
  • Ensure all legal and company standards are met, particularly in areas related to the sale of alcohol, food preparation and service, gambling, and bingo.
  • Ensure the safety and cleanliness of all retail areas, including the cellar, maintaining high-quality products and compliance with health and safety legislation.
  • Set high standards of service throughout the business, ensuring that guests receive a memorable and enjoyable experience.
  • Provide comprehensive product knowledge and ensure that all team members are trained and qualified to meet the company’s standards.
